Filippo parts ways with FUT

Written by m4d0o3e

Filippo and FUT Esports have announced they have parted ways. It has been an unsuccessful start to 2024 for the high standards of both the player and the org and it would not be controversial to say that these have not been reached thus far.

Despite qualifying for the first Monthly Final, FUT had an early exit as they were reverse swept by Oceanus Gaming in the quarter finals. This qualification too was not the smoothest, as it required the disqualification of one of their Lower Bracket opponents. Bad turned to worse this month, however, as they failed to even qualify, as they lost to Eclipsar Esport in the final round of the Lower Bracket. 

Filippo was trusted this year by FUT Esports as somewhat of a rookie but is by no means a bad player. However, in his time as a professional player, he has found it difficult to hold down a roster for a long time, playing for OneTrickPonies on 4 different stints as well as playing with VN Esporting, HMBLE (twice) and F/A MrDoSa before joining the Turkish organisation. His talent is clear to see, but the question comes over consistency.

For both parties, there doesn't seem to be many replacements in sight, though that is what we said when Mebius left VN, only to be proven wrong almost instantly. But VN have just added blaksxy, and Mric joined Synchronic Gaming, eliminating the two most viable F/A options. If FUT are to sign someone, it will have to be someone already in a team, or someone very unexpected. Likewise for Filippo, he will probably replace someone in a roster, or join as a 4th, which he may not want to do.

Since the writing of the article, Buzko announced on X that he would be leaving VN Esporting. Perhaps this is an opportunity for Filippo to join forces with the roster, but what seems more likely is that the roster disbands because of one of them joining FUT. Rama announced he had signed a contract, which could indicate he is joining FUT, but potentially has signed for a new org with his current team, due to the financial issues with VN.

Either way, both player and org seem to be happy with this decision. Hopefully, they can both reach a situation where they reach successful positions this year.
